From 1d240b22d5f797372e48b81e51fa72c92f843e08 Mon Sep 17 00:00:00 2001 From: Mauro Sardara Date: Mon, 23 Jan 2023 16:24:35 +0000 Subject: fix(libhicnctrl): do not swap bytes when using vapi Signed-off-by: Mauro Sardara Change-Id: If1666dd5c31c662570ed10991b3d42d6095693ff --- ctrl/libhicnctrl/src/modules/hicn_plugin/strategy.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ctrl/libhicnctrl/src/modules/hicn_plugin/strategy.c b/ctrl/libhicnctrl/src/modules/hicn_plugin/strategy.c index f8f6536ff..17d29a1d7 100644 --- a/ctrl/libhicnctrl/src/modules/hicn_plugin/strategy.c +++ b/ctrl/libhicnctrl/src/modules/hicn_plugin/strategy.c @@ -82,7 +82,7 @@ static int _vpp_strategy_set(hc_sock_vpp_data_t *s, vapi_alloc_hicn_api_strategy_set(s->g_vapi_ctx_instance); // Fill it - msg->payload.strategy_id = clib_host_to_net_u32(strategy_id); + msg->payload.strategy_id = strategy_id; ret = _ip_prefix_encode(&strategy->address, strategy->len, strategy->family, &msg->payload.prefix); -- cgit 1.2.3-korg